About Natural Bread, Oxford

Natural Bread is an independent Oxford based artisan bakery. We make all our own wonderful breads, pastries & cakes by hand, from scratch, and fresh every day in our Botley bakery without using any additives.

Our signature natural sourdough breads are made using locally milled flour, sourdough starter, water, salt and time and while other bakeries might use yeast to get their breads to rise, we use traditional natural leaven, slow fermentation techniques letting the sourdough starter do its job over 48 hours – giving the bread its wonderful texture & depth of flavour.

We have a successful wholesale business supplying breads, pastries and cakes to restaurants, cafés & stockists across Oxfordshire, and a selection of our breads, cakes & pastries is available to buy each day from our bakery shops in Oxford City and Woodstock.
